ESE 2019 – For the First Time UPSC Allows Application Withdraw Facility to Candidates

By : Swati Sharma |

The Union Public Service Commission has allowed the facility of withdrawal of applications by candidates. Candidates who applied for Engineering Services Examination 2019 and now wish to withdraw the application form can do so till November 5, 2018 (18:00 hrs). This revolutionary step is taken by UPSC for Engineering Services Exam 2019 and more recruitment examinations will be brought under this arrangement.

Around one month back, the UPSC Chairman Shri Arvind Saxena said that UPSC’s experience with the Civil Services Examination is that roughly 50% of the 10 lakh plus candidates who fill in the application forms for the Preliminary examination actually write the examination. “The Commission has to book venues, print papers, hire invigilators and ship the documents for all the 10 lakh applicants – which turns out to be a 50% waste of energy and resources”, he said. “UPSC’s view is that if we are able to work with genuine and serious candidates, we can give them better facilities and make our system more efficient”, he added.

Important Instructions for Withdrawal of Application

1. Candidates are advised to provide the details of registered application with registration-id which was completed and submitted finally. There is no provision for withdrawing of incomplete applications.
2. Before making the request for withdrawal, the candidate must ensure the availability of registered mobile number and email-id as provided while submitting the application. The request will be accepted only after the confirmation by validating the OTP details sent on the candidate’s mobile and email, such OTP will be valid for 30 Minutes. In case the OTP is not received within 10 Minutes resend option is also available.
3. Request for generating OTP for withdrawal of application will be accepted only till 5.30 PM on 05-11-2018.
4. If a candidate has submitted more than one application form, then the higher registration-id for the latest completed application will be considered for withdrawal. All earlier applications will be treated as canceled automatically and a message informing withdrawal of application will be delivered on the registered mobile and email.
5. After the final acceptance of the request for online withdrawal of application the candidate must print the authenticated receipt. Once the application is withdrawn by the candidate, it will not be revived in future.
6. UPSC has no provision to refund any fee amount paid by candidates so even in case of successful withdrawn of application the fees will not be refunded.
7. On successful completion of withdrawal of the application, an auto-generated email and SMS will be sent to the candidate’s registered email-id and mobile respectively. In case a candidate has not submitted the request for withdrawal of application he/she may contact UPSC on email-id – [email protected]
8. Candidates are advised not to share OTP received on email/SMS with anybody.
